I tried to use my Kings LA2016 in PulseView, but it doesn't seem to find the firmware files.
What I did:
1. Downloaded linux software from manufacturer,
2. Downloaded sigrok-util snapshot (commit hash 6e6c47d),
3. Used the script to extract fw/bitstream files,
4. Copied the firmware to various locations where PulseView is supposed to find them,
5. Confirmed in About section both locations and the fact that firmware was not correctly recognized

Comment 7 Soeren Apel 2020-07-29 13:12:14 CEST
Hello, the driver was added on June 6th: https://sigrok.org/gitweb/?p=libsigrok.git;a=commit;h=f2cd2debf9dcbf0e83ec70d8ea41d8421a400dfd

PV 0.4.2 was released on Mar 31st. That's why you don't see the kingst-la2016 driver in the driver list.

Please try again using a nightly build.
